You'll be a first point of contact for legal queries alongside our awesome team of legal counsel, offering invaluable support and advice. You'll also know when it's appropriate to escalate or cross-refer within the function to ensure a high-quality legal support service is provided.
Accountabilities:

  • Coordinate our contract review and execution process, advising business teams on third-party contract terms and facilitating communication with external counsel.

  • Assist in drafting, reviewing, and managing contracts, ensuring legal compliance.

  • Organise legal documents and records, including contracts and corporate filings, using document management systems.

  • Support our Company Secretary with corporate governance activities, including drafting resolutions and ensuring statutory compliance.

  • Assist our Data Protection Officer (DPO) in maintaining data privacy artifacts and ensuring compliance with data protection laws.


  • Responsibilities:
  • Conduct legal research on regulations, case law and industry standards.

  • Support our legal team in managing and protecting intellectual property assets.

  • Assist our legal counsel in litigation support, including evidence gathering and document preparation.

  • Identify legal risks, supporting the General Counsel with our risk management process and providing advice to mitigate risks.

  • Assist in internal investigations concerning regulatory and legal matters.

  • Provide support in corporate transactions such as mergers, acquisitions, and joint ventures.

  • Offer training and guidance to business teams on legal matters.

  • Assist in managing and tracking legal costs and external legal spend.

  • Undertake additional responsibilities or tasks as required by the legal team.

We support various ways of working, including predominantly remote, office-based, or a mix of both worlds., Pod Point is the UK's leading electric vehicle (EV) charging provider. Since 2009, we've provided over 220,000 chargepoints, leading the UK's transition to electric cars and making EV ownership easy and affordable for everyone.
    We're partnering with automotive giants like Mercedes-Benz, Hyundai, Jaguar Land Rover and BMW, as well as energy leaders Centrica and EDF. Our focus includes innovative ventures like advanced smart charging solutions and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S). Additionally, we collaborate with Taylor Wimpey, Redrow and Barratt Developments to establish EV charging infrastructure in new homes.
